Output 7c4888040612652f687bbedcc41213d0f06045cb31cd405b0e291843b2890268:0

value
33306999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572f58a9f26fcc34d73a88e9a622b41cc36e5f6d OP_EQUAL
address
39e1RuzxUipunTLx8bVEuYpvf336CnfbhE
transaction
7c4888040612652f687bbedcc41213d0f06045cb31cd405b0e291843b2890268
spent
true